Embrace Sustainability: 10 Detailed Sustainable Home Decor Ideas for Eco-Friendly Living
In a world where environmental consciousness is increasingly at the forefront of our minds, it's no surprise that sustainable home decor has become a growing trend. Not only does it help reduce our carbon footprint, but it also adds a unique and stylish touch to our living spaces. If you're looking to make your home more eco-friendly, here are 10 detailed sustainable home decor ideas to inspire you:

1. Upcycled Furniture:

Upcycling old furniture is a fantastic way to breathe new life into tired pieces while reducing waste. Whether it's repainting a vintage dresser, reupholstering a worn-out chair, or turning pallets into a coffee table, upcycled furniture adds character and charm to any room.

2. Vintage and Secondhand Shopping:

Instead of buying new, consider shopping for vintage or secondhand furniture and decor items. Not only does this reduce the demand for new materials, but it also gives old pieces a second chance. Explore thrift stores, flea markets, and online marketplaces for unique finds that tell a story.

3. Natural Materials:

Choose decor items made from sustainable and renewable materials like bamboo, reclaimed wood, cork, hemp, and organic cotton. These materials not only have a lower environmental impact but also bring a sense of warmth and authenticity to your home.

4. Indoor Plants:

Incorporating indoor plants into your decor not only adds a touch of greenery but also improves air quality and promotes a sense of well-being. Choose low-maintenance plants like pothos, snake plants, and succulents to effortlessly elevate your space.

5. Energy-Efficient Lighting:

Opt for energy-efficient LED light bulbs and fixtures to reduce energy consumption and lower your carbon footprint. Consider installing dimmer switches or smart lighting systems for added control and efficiency.

6. DIY Projects:

Get creative and embark on DIY projects using recycled or repurposed materials. From homemade candles and upcycled planters to DIY artwork and recycled glass vases, there's no shortage of sustainable decor projects to explore.

7. Zero-Waste Decor:

Embrace a zero-waste lifestyle by choosing decor items with minimal packaging or opting for package-free alternatives. Look for products made from recycled materials or those that can be easily recycled or composted at the end of their life.

8. Minimalism:

Adopting a minimalist approach to home decor not only reduces clutter but also encourages mindful consumption. Prioritize quality over quantity, invest in timeless pieces, and declutter regularly to create a calm and harmonious living space.

9. Energy-Efficient Window Treatments:

Install energy-efficient window treatments like thermal curtains or blinds to reduce heat loss in the winter and keep your home cool in the summer. This simple upgrade not only saves energy but also enhances comfort and aesthetics.

10. Natural Cleaning Products:

Switch to eco-friendly and non-toxic cleaning products to maintain a healthy and sustainable home environment. Choose plant-based cleaners or make your own using simple ingredients like vinegar, baking soda, and essential oils.

By incorporating these detailed sustainable home decor ideas into your living space, you can create a home that not only reflects your style but also respects the planet. Let's embrace sustainability and make a positive difference, one decor choice at a time.
